The 2010 July-August deep XMM-Newton observations of M33 fields revealed a new bright X-ray source XMMU J013359.5+303634 exhibiting pulsations with a period P~285.4 s and pulsed fraction ~47 per cent in the 0.3-10 keV energy range. The pulse phase averaged spectrum of XMMU J013359.5+303634 is typical of X-ray pulsars and can be fit with an absorbed simple power law model of photon index Gamma~1.2 in the 0.3-10 keV energy band. The search for an optical counterpart did not yield any stellar object brighter than 20 mag, suggesting that XMMU J013359.5+303634 is not a Galactic foreground object and almost certainly belongs to M33. Assuming the distance of 817 kpc, the maximum observed luminosity of the source in the 0.3-10 keV energy range is ~1.4e37 ergs/s, at least 20 times higher than quiescent luminosity. The brightest optical object inside the error circle of XMMU J013359.5+303634 has a visual magnitude of 20.9 and properties consistent with being an early B V star when placed at a distance of M33.
